What is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D)?
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that impacts learning, communication, behavior, and social interaction. It is described as a “spectrum” because the symptoms and challenges can vary greatly in type and severity from one individual to another. Children and adults with ASD may experience difficulties in social interaction and communication, along with restricted or repetitive patterns of behavior, interests, or activities. Early identification and timely intervention are critical to supporting optimal development, yet in many resource-limited settings, delays in detection often prevent children from receiving the essential support they need.
Ahaan Foundation launched this initiative to bridge the gap in early identification and support for children with ASD. The program focuses on children aged 3-10 years, offering a 2-day intensive training that equips pre-primary and primary school teachers in the state of Goa, as well as Anganwadi caregivers in Ambarnath, Thane, with the skills to recognize early signs of autism and engage effectively with parents.
By strengthening awareness and early intervention capabilities among secondary caregivers, our ultimate goal is to build inclusive classrooms and nurturing, supportive environments where children with ASD and their families can thrive. We have created a structured system where educators can report suspected cases of ASD to Ahaan Foundation’s Counsellors.

Programme Overview:
Goa (North & South):
Educators, including pre-primary and primary school teachers – from newly trained to seasoned professionals – across North and South Goa, representing both state and central boards, can participate in the ASD – Early Detection Project sensitization programme. The 2-day training focuses on equipping teachers with essential knowledge and skills for the early identification and support of children exhibiting atypical developmental patterns. A key highlight is the introduction of the Chandigarh Autism Screening Instrument (CASI), an effective preliminary screening tool designed to aid in the early detection of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D).

Our Initiatives
Responsible Netism: A flagship project committed to safeguarding netizens in cyber space.
CYBER WELLNESS HELPLINE
Responsible Netism is a social purpose initiative committed to the cause of women and child online protection and cyber wellness.
Project Responsible Netism was established by Ahaan Foundation in 2012, with the primary objective of protecting the safety rights of children and women in cyberspace. Through our movement, we advocate for cyber wellness, raise awareness, educate individuals about digital safety, and promote responsible online behaviour. Our efforts have been initiated in the states of Maharashtra, Goa, Madhya Pradesh, and Rajasthan.
We have successfully educated over 1.8 million children and more than 1 million adults through our educational and training programmes.
